Kubasaki High School is a Department of Defense Education Activity (DoDEA) school located on the island of Okinawa, Japan, serving U.S. military families. As one of the oldest overseas American schools in the DoDEA system, it has a rich history dating back to its founding in 1946. The school provides education for students in grades 9-12 and offers a variety of academic programs, including Advanced Placement (AP) courses, catering to a diverse student body largely consisting of children of military personnel stationed in the region. In addition to academics, Kubasaki High School offers a range of extracurricular activities such as sports, clubs, and arts programs, aimed at promoting a well-rounded educational experience. The school is known for fostering a strong sense of community and support among students, staff, and parents, all within the unique cultural setting of Okinawa.
